Mexico Repatriates Six Citizens Detained After Gaza Aid Flotilla Interception

The group has left Israel for Amman after consular negotiations, with Mexican diplomats escorting their return to Mexico City.

Overview

  • The Foreign Ministry said the six — Sol González Eguía, Ernesto Ledesma Arronte, Arlín Medrano Guzmán, Carlos Pérez Osorio, Diego Vázquez Galindo, and Laura Alejandra Vélez Ruiz Gaitán — were transferred to Amman and are en route to Mexico City.
  • Israel authorized the repatriation following consular visits at the Ketziot detention center, where Mexican officials also arranged needed medication.
  • Ambassadors Mauricio Escanero (Israel) and Jacob Prado (Jordan) received the group in Amman and will accompany the journey home under a protection protocol.
  • The detainees were held after Israel intercepted the Global Sumud Flotilla in international waters during its attempt to deliver humanitarian aid to Gaza.
  • Mexico thanked Jordan for facilitating entry, as broader deportations of flotilla participants continue, including 171 activists flown to Europe according to Israeli statements.
